Oklahoma City, OK (population: 564,147) has thirteen business and finance schools within its city limits. Oklahoma City University, the highest ranked school in the city with a business and finance program, has a total student population of 3,829. It is the 310th highest ranked school in the USA and the highest in the state of Oklahoma. Business and Finance students from Oklahoma City schools who go on to become business and finance professionals, event planners, web developers, SEOs, etc. have a good chance at finding employment. For example, there are 6,063,670 people working as business and financial operations employees alone in the US, and their average annual salary is $65,900. Also, Wholesale and retail buyers make on average $55,480 per year and there are about 116,900 of them employed in the US today. In fact, in the Oklahoma City area alone, there are 630 employed wholesale and retail buyers earning an average salary of $43,560. Business and financial operations employees in this area earn $53,920/yr and there are 26,920 employed.
Oklahoma City lies in Oklahoma county, which is one of the 41 counties in Oklahoma. Overall, the Oklahoma City area has 564,710 total employed workers according to the US Bureau of Labor Statistics, with a 1.5% unemployment rate, $18.31/hr average worker wage, and a $38,090 average annual salary. Thus, about 47.675 out of every 1000 jobs in Oklahoma City are held by business and financial operations employees, and 1.124/1000 are held by wholesale and retail buyers.
Of the 13 business and finance schools in Oklahoma City, only 1 has a student population over 10k. After taking into account tuition, living expenses, and financial aid, Platt College comes out as the most expensive ($28,795/yr) for business and finance students, with Oklahoma State University-Oklahoma City as the lowest, reported at only $5,899/yr.
